Please sync digitaldj (universe) from Debian unstable (main).
Explanation of the Ubuntu delta and why it can be dropped:
The only Ubuntu change was to replace the depricated CLK_TCK with CLOCKS_PER_SEC. This has now been done in Debian, as shown in the changelog.
Changelog since current gutsy version 0.7.5-5ubuntu1:
digitaldj (0.7.5-6) unstable; urgency=low
* Use CLOCKS_PER_SEC instead of deprecated CLK_TCK (closes: 376772, 420943)
* Apply patch to make digitaldj build on freebsd (closes: 413937)
* Update to policy version 3.7.2
* Update watch file
-- Tim Dijkstra <tim at famdijkstra.org> Mon, 14 May 2007 23:04:45 +0200
